Fabricated mobile house
By introducing multi-partition and sliding door designs into prefabricated mobile homes, the problem of monotonous interior space is solved, and functionality and privacy are improved. Adjustable partitions and sliding doors can adapt to different needs, while also increasing the practicality of folding clothes racks.

TECHNICAL FIELD
[0001] The utility model relates to prefabricated building construction technical field, especially a kind of prefabricated mobile house. BACKGROUND
[0002] Prefabricated mobile house refers to the main structure of house, such as beam, column, board and so on, or all components are prefabricated in factory, then are transported to site and are assembled reasonably, and the building formed has use function.In recent years, prefabricated mobile house has been more and more widely used in the field of rescue and disaster relief, construction site or temporary military deployment, etc., compared with traditional house, with the advantages of being able to move, disassembling and assembling conveniently, and strong site adaptability.The internal space of existing prefabricated mobile house is single, lacks obvious space division, causes the internal function of house to be chaotic, and is inconvenient to use. DETAILED DESCRIPTION
[0023] As Figures 1-7 The utility model discloses a prefabricated mobile house, including house main part, the bottom surface of house main part is installed with house bottom plate 1, the four sides of house main part are all installed with combined roof panel, the top surface of house main part is installed with roof 5, is installed with house door 6 on the combined roof panel of the front, is installed with window 7 on the combined roof panel of side, the top surface of house bottom plate 1 is connected with multiple stand columns 2 through bolt, and stand column 2 is located at the four corners of house bottom plate 1 and the connecting position of first partition 8, second partition 9, third partition 10, the combined roof panel is connected on the outside of stand column 2 through bolt, the inside of house main part is installed with first partition 8, the front of first partition 8 is installed with second partition 9, the position close to left and right sides below second partition 9 is installed with third partition 10, and two movable doors 11 are installed between two third partition 10s;First partition 8 is installed in the middle position of second partition 9, and first partition 8 and second partition 9 are arranged in T shape;The rear of second partition 9 is installed with chute 12, and movable door 11 moves along chute 12;By setting first partition 8, second partition 9, third partition 10, the inside of house main part is divided into multiple independent spaces, first space is after entering from house door 6, and after pushing two movable doors 11, second space and third space located in the rear side can be respectively used, by the division of multiple spaces, the functionality of house is increased, and simultaneously, by the design of movable door 11, the privacy of space is increased;The size of first partition 8, second partition 9, third partition 10 can be adjusted according to actual needs, and the size of multiple spaces and movable door 11 can be changed according to needs, so the adaptability is strong.
[0024] The combined roof panel on the front and rear sides is also installed with a lifting ring, and the entire mobile house can be lifted by using the lifting ring, so that the mobile house is convenient to move.
[0025] As Figure 2 , 3 shown, the combined roof panel comprises a first roof panel 3 and a second roof panel 4, the first roof panel 3 is spliced above the second roof panel 4, the bottom of the first roof panel 3 is provided with a groove 3-1, and the top of the second roof panel 4 is connected with a protrusion 4-1 matched with the groove 3-1; the first roof panel 3 and the second roof panel 4 are spliced together to form a combined roof panel, compared with an integral roof panel, the area of the roof panel is reduced, and processing and transportation are facilitated.
[0026] As Figure 4 shown, folding clothes drying racks 13 are installed on the left and right sides of the house body; as Figure 7 shown, the folding clothes drying rack 13 comprises two installation plates 13-1 arranged side by side front and back, the installation plates 13-1 are connected to the outer side of the combined roof panel through bolts, the side of the installation plate 13-1 away from the combined roof panel is connected with a mounting seat 13-2, a driving mechanism is arranged below the mounting seat 13-2, and folding frames 13-3 are arranged on the mounting seat 13-2 and the driving mechanism.
[0027] Specifically, the driving mechanism comprises a motor 13-6, the motor 13-6 is installed on the installation plate 13-1, a lead screw 13-5 is connected to the output shaft of the motor 13-6, the lead screw 13-5 is rotatably installed on the installation plate 13-1 through a support and a bearing, a moving block 13-7 is threadedly connected to the lead screw 13-5, the upper end of the folding frame 13-3 is hinged to the mounting seat 13-2, and the lower end of the folding frame 13-3 is hinged to the moving block 13-7; the folding frame 13-3 is hinged by a plurality of connecting rods; in use, the motor 13-6 is started, the motor 13-6 drives the lead screw 13-5 to rotate, the lead screw 13-5 drives the moving block 13-7 to move, when the moving block 13-7 moves upwards, the folding frame 13-3 is unfolded, the distance between adjacent two horizontal rods 13-4 is increased, and the clothes are conveniently dried; when the moving block 13-7 moves downwards, the folding frame 13-3 is folded, and the space occupation is reduced.
[0028] In the embodiment, the house bottom plate 1, the column 2, the first roof panel 3, the second roof panel 4, the roof 5, the first partition plate 8, the second partition plate 9, the third partition plate 10 and the movable door 11 are all prefabricated in a factory.
[0029] The assembly process of the utility model is as follows:
[0030] After being transported to the site, the floor 1 is first fixed on the ground, then the columns 2 are installed at the four corners of the floor 1 and the connecting positions of the first partition 8, the second partition 9 and the third partition 10 by means of bolts, after that, the first roof panel 3 is installed and connected with the columns 2 by means of bolts, then the second roof panel 4 is installed above the first roof panel 3, the protrusion 4-1 is inserted into the groove 3-1, and the second roof panel 4 is connected with the columns 2 by means of bolts, thereby the combined roof panel is installed around the floor 1, after that, the first partition 8, the second partition 9, the third partition 10 and the sliding door 11 are installed inside, then the roof 5 is installed on the top and connected with the columns 2, the first roof panel 3 and the second roof panel 4 by means of bolts, thereby the assembly of the main body of the house is completed, finally, the door 6, the window 7 and the folding clothes drying rack 13 are installed.
